Background
The Union Territory of Jammu and Kashmir (J&K) is characterized by a unique and complex topography, ranging from the high-altitude Himalayan valleys to the Pir Panjal range. While geographically distinct, this position makes the region exceptionally vulnerable to diverse natural and human-induced hazards. The territory is classified primarily under Seismic Zones IV and V, signifying a very high risk of high-intensity earthquakes. Historically, J&K has been scarred by devastating events, including the 2005 Waltengu Nad snowstorm that claimed over 175 lives, the October 2005 earthquake that killed approximately 1,350 people in the UT, and the September 2014 floods, which resulted in nearly 460 deaths and billions of dollars in infrastructure damage (NOAA).
The statutory foundation for managing these risks is the National Disaster Management Act, 2005, which requires every state and UT to formulate a comprehensive roadmap. Under Section 23(1) of this Act, the Jammu and Kashmir State Disaster Management Plan (SDMP) 2022-23 was established to facilitate a paradigm shift from a reactive, relief-centric approach to a proactive, holistic strategy focused on Disaster Risk Reduction (DRR). This 2022-23 framework aligns with the global Sendai Framework (2015-2030) and the Prime Minister’s 10-Point Agenda, aiming to integrate risk mitigation into all levels of developmental planning to ensure long-term strategic resilience.
Functioning
The SDMP 2022-23 operates through a robust, multi-tiered institutional mechanism that ensures coordinated governance from the Union Territory level down to the individual tehsils.
- Institutional Framework: At the apex is the J&K State Disaster Management Authority (JKDMA), chaired by the Lieutenant Governor, which is responsible for laying down policies and approving plans. The State Executive Committee (SEC), headed by the Chief Secretary, coordinates the implementation of these policies across departments. At the local level, District Disaster Management Authorities (DDMAs), led by Deputy Commissioners, act as the primary bodies for planning and implementing measures within their respective districts.
- Universal Postulates and Incident Response System (IRS): Under the Jammu and Kashmir Disaster Management Plan 2022-23, the “Universal Postulates” represent the core stages of the disaster cycle, while the Incident Response System (IRS) acts as the statutory administrative engine to execute these stages effectively during a crisis. Five Universal Postulates of Disaster Management are:
- Prevention: Measures to avoid disasters or prevent manageable risks from becoming major catastrophes through planning, regulation, and risk reduction.
- Mitigation: Long-term structural and non-structural measures to reduce disaster impacts, such as resilient infrastructure and public awareness.
- Preparedness: Advance planning, training, early warning systems, and Emergency Operation Centres (EOCs) to ensure an effective response.
- Response: Immediate actions during or after a disaster to save lives, provide relief, conduct evacuations, and coordinate emergency services.
- Recovery: Restoration and reconstruction using the Build Back Better (BBB) approach to improve resilience after disasters.
Incident Response System (IRS)
- Pre-Designated Accountability: Roles and responsibilities are assigned in advance to ensure clear accountability and avoid duplication.
- Hierarchical Management: A unified command led by the Incident Commander (IC) enables coordinated decision-making and resource deployment.
- Grassroots Extension: The IRS functions down to the tehsil level, allowing local authorities to manage Level 1 (L1) disasters effectively.
- Inter-Agency Coordination: Provides a common framework for civil administration, security forces, and NGOs to coordinate rescue, relief, and logistics.
- Activation Triggers: Incident Response Teams are activated immediately after warnings or disasters, with responses scaled according to disaster severity (L1–L3).
- Emergency Support Functions (ESF): The SDMP identifies critical services—such as early warning, evacuation, medical care, and search and rescue—and assigns primary and secondary departments to each. For example, the Revenue Department serves as the nodal agency for relief and rehabilitation, while the SDRF and NDRF lead specialized search and rescue operations.
- Technological and Digital Integration: The plan integrates advanced tools like the Digital Risk Database (DRDB) and the Integrated Operational Forecasting System (IOFS). It also prioritizes the use of the Common Alerting Protocol (CAP) and mobile applications such as SACHET, Damini, and Mausam for the rapid, last-mile dissemination of weather alerts and early warnings to the general public.
Performance
As of early 2026, the performance of J&K’s disaster management framework is evidenced by significant financial mobilizations and the completion of major infrastructure projects intended to modernize the UT’s response capacity.
- Financial Commitment and Action Plans: The J&K administration has approved a ₹3,340 crore action plan to strengthen disaster preparedness through improved early warning systems, modern emergency response infrastructure, and enhanced institutional capacity. In addition, the Ministry of Home Affairs has sanctioned over ₹1,500 crore for recovery, reconstruction, and rehabilitation following recent extreme weather events. These investments have resulted in measurable improvements, such as faster emergency response times, wider coverage of early warning systems, stronger institutional coordination, and reduced disaster-related losses.
- Infrastructure and “Nerve Centres”: A major milestone is the construction of the State Emergency Operation Centre (EOC) at Budgam, expected to be fully operational by August 2026. Equipped with redundant communication systems, real-time monitoring, and coordination facilities, it will function as the central command hub for disaster management across Jammu and Kashmir.
- Community Capacity Building: More than 97,000 Aapda Mitras have been trained across disaster-prone districts in first aid, evacuation, search and rescue, and community awareness.2 The administration has also enlisted and trained local divers in flood-prone districts to strengthen water rescue operations and improve the availability of local first responders.
- Pilgrimage and Crowd Management: Disaster preparedness for major religious pilgrimages has been strengthened through RFID-based pilgrim tracking, regular mock drills, and dedicated emergency response plans. Special preparedness measures at Shri Mata Vaishno Devi, which receives an average of around 26,000 pilgrims daily (with numbers exceeding 40,000 per day during peak periods such as Navratras), and the seasonal Machail Mata Yatra, where authorities regulate the movement of up to 8,000 pilgrims on foot and 700 by helicopter each day, aim to improve crowd management, emergency evacuation, communication, and response to landslides and other hazards in high-altitude terrain (SMVDSB).
- Early Warning and Preparedness: The government has expanded multi-hazard early warning systems by integrating weather forecasts, communication networks, and digital alert platforms. Regular mock exercises, inter-agency coordination drills, and public awareness campaigns have improved preparedness and response readiness at the district and local levels.
- Institutional Strengthening: District Emergency Operation Centres (DEOCs) with one established in each of Jammu and Kashmir’s 20 districts, and Incident Response Teams (IRTs) have been strengthened through updated disaster management plans, improved coordination mechanisms, and capacity-building programmes. These initiatives have enhanced the ability of district administrations to respond quickly and effectively to emergencies.
Impact
The execution of the SDMP 2022-23 and its subsequent intensifications are fundamentally shifting the Union Territory toward an anticipatory disaster management culture.
- Transition to a Preparedness-Oriented Approach: The implementation of the State Disaster Management Plan (SDMP) 2022–23 has shifted disaster management in Jammu and Kashmir from a largely relief-centric approach to one centred on preparedness and risk reduction. District administrations are now required to undertake pre-monsoon preparedness drills, update contingency plans, and conduct mock exercises before the April–September monsoon season, improving institutional readiness for floods, cloudbursts, and landslides.
- Mainstreaming Disaster Risk Reduction (DRR): Disaster Risk Reduction has increasingly been integrated into development planning across key departments such as Housing, Public Works (R&B), Jal Shakti, and Urban Development. Infrastructure projects now incorporate earthquake-resistant construction standards, floodplain mapping, slope stabilisation, and hazard assessments, reducing the likelihood that new development will create or exacerbate disaster risks.
- Strengthened Institutional Coordination: The establishment of Joint Control Rooms, Emergency Operation Centres (EOCs), and the Incident Response System (IRS) has improved coordination between the civil administration, the Army, Central Armed Police Forces (CAPFs), the National Disaster Response Force (NDRF), and other emergency agencies. This unified command structure has enabled quicker decision-making, more efficient deployment of resources, and better coordination during multi-hazard emergencies.
- Greater Community Resilience: Capacity-building initiatives such as the training of Aapda Mitras, village-level awareness programmes, school safety campaigns, and regular mock drills have strengthened community preparedness. These measures have enhanced local response capabilities, reduced dependence on external assistance during the initial hours of disasters, and promoted a culture of disaster awareness.
- Inclusive Disaster Governance: The SDMP adopts an inclusive approach by recognising the specific needs of women, children, older persons, and persons with disabilities during preparedness, evacuation, relief, and rehabilitation. It encourages accessible shelters, targeted relief measures, and community participation to ensure that vulnerable groups are not disproportionately affected during disasters.
- Environmental and Ecosystem Resilience: The plan recognises environmental degradation as a driver of disaster risk and promotes forest regeneration, watershed management, slope stabilisation, wetland conservation, and catchment area treatment. These ecosystem-based measures help improve water retention, reduce soil erosion, minimise landslide risks, and mitigate the intensity of flash floods and cloudbursts in vulnerable mountain regions.
- Improved Early Warning and Response Capacity: Investments in modern communication systems, digital early warning platforms, and upgraded Emergency Operation Centres have enhanced the government’s ability to disseminate timely alerts and coordinate emergency responses. Faster information sharing and improved situational awareness have reduced response times and strengthened the overall effectiveness of disaster management across the Union Territory.
Emerging Issues
Despite these advancements, several systemic challenges and “breaking points” continue to threaten the region’s safety.
- Natural “Bowl” Vulnerability: Srinagar and its adjoining areas are “bowl-shaped,” which causes natural drainage congestion. Water flows easily from high-altitude catchments into the central plain but has very few exit points, effectively turning the city into a flood trap during extreme rain.
- Loss of Natural Sponges: Massive urbanization over the last four decades has erased the wetlands, floodplains, and marshes that historically acted as buffers. The Dal Lake, for example, has shrunk to a fraction of its original size and lost significant depth, leading to a reduced carrying capacity of the Valley’s water bodies.
- Climate Change and “New Normals”: Analysis shows that the “return period” for extreme rainfall (exceeding 64.5 mm per day) is shortening. Deluges previously considered “rarest of rare,” like the 2014 flood, are projected to occur more frequently as climate cycles accelerate.
- The Cloudburst and GLOF Threat: J&K witnessed nearly 168 cloudbursts (IMD) between 2010 and 2022. The region’s young, unstable mountains and loose soil make these events catastrophic, as they often trigger massive landslides and potentially Glacial Lake Outburst Floods (GLOFs).
- Data and Research Gaps: Experts have highlighted a critical lack of a dedicated baseline data portal for environmental parameters in J&K. Additionally, much of the academic research conducted in local universities remains unapplied to the day-to-day administrative practices of disaster management.
Way Forward
To reconcile its developmental goals with its high-risk profile, the SDMP must evolve through a “science-based and sustainable” reset.
- Scientific and High-Tech Interventions: The government should prioritize the deployment of Doppler Radars and high-precision sensors (piezometers) in high-risk zones to detect rock mass changes and provide warnings before landslides or dam breaches occur.
- Strict Carrying Capacity Regulations: Authorities must conduct rigorous carrying capacity studies for high-altitude tourism and pilgrimages, regulating footfall and construction to match the ecological sensitivity of the terrain.
- Enforcement of Policy Reforms: Long-term resilience depends on the strict enforcement of building bye-laws, land-use regulations, and floodplain zoning to prevent further encroachment on natural drainage channels.
- Applicable Research Integration: There is an urgent need to create a coherent system between educational institutions and the administration, ensuring that local PhD research and scientific studies are utilized to inform field-level disaster management practices.
- Strengthening Last-Mile Early Warning: Moving beyond digital apps, the administration must ensure redundant communication channels—such as satellite phones and VHF links are functional in remote and border areas where internet connectivity is inconsistent.
- AI-Assisted Forecasting and Decision Support: Artificial intelligence and machine learning should be integrated with meteorological, hydrological, and satellite data to improve the forecasting of cloudbursts, flash floods, landslides, and glacial lake outburst floods. AI-enabled decision support systems can enhance risk mapping, provide location-specific early warnings, and assist authorities in resource allocation and evacuation planning during emergencies.
By shifting the focus from event-driven response to systemic prevention and applicable science, Jammu and Kashmir can leverage its 2022-23 roadmap to protect its people and its fragile ecosystem for generations to come
